Special news report: Our big backyard

In this four part series, KUOW's Marcie Sillman explores the creeks in our midst: Their aesthetic and psychological value, the impact of urbanization, remediation efforts, and the importance of community involvement in urban creek preservation.

Stream Team Newsletter

Stream Team's mission is "to protect and enhance the water resources, associated habitats, and wildlife of North Thurston County through citizen education and action." This quarterly newlsetter provides articles, events calendar, and team contact information.
